CCMA – Detailed Overview
The Commission for Conciliation, Mediation, and Arbitration was established in 1996 in South Africa to promote fair labor practices and resolve workplace disputes. As an independent body, the CCMA plays a significant role in mediating conflicts between employers and employees. Numerous cases are handled annually, and this has become an important factor in industrial peace. The institution’s effectiveness is visible through its high-resolution rate and capacity to handle a wide range of worker issues, from unfair dismissals to wage disputes.
The CCMA offers a wide range of services aimed at creating cooperative labor relations. These services include conciliation, mediation, arbitration, and advisory functions. The institution is renowned for its individualized approach, as it ensures that both employers and employees receive fair treatment and resolutions. Its commitment to transparency and efficiency has earned it high satisfaction rates. By providing accessible and impartial services, it significantly contributes to a stable and fair work market in South Africa.
